EXPLANATORY STATEMENT PURSUANT TO SECTION 102 OF THE COMPANIES ACT, 2013 SETTING OUT THE MATERIAL FACTS FOR THE PROPOSED SPECIAL RESOLUTION ACCOMPANYING THE POSTAL BALLOT NOTICE
Item No. 1
As required by Section 102 of the Act, the following explanatory statement sets out all material facts relating to the businesses mentioned under resolution of the accompanying Notice.
Mr Manoj Kumar Digga assumed the role of Chief Operating Officer of the Company on September 15, 2020, and became a key member of the Leadership Team. Recognizing Mr. Manoj Kumar Digga’s significant contributions and aligning with the Company’s talent strategy, the Board, via its approval at its meeting held on 30th May, 2024, based on the recommendation of the, Nomination and Remuneration Committee, recommends the appointment of Mr. Manoj Kumar Digga as a Director of the Company, effective from May 30, 2024, designated as “Executive Director”, for a term of 5 years until May 29, 2029. During his tenure as Director of the Company, he shall be subject to retirement by rotation in accordance with the provisions of the Companies Act, 2013 and the Articles of Association of the Company.
Furthermore, the appointment of Mr Manoj Kumar Digga as Executive Director, effective May 30, 2024, and the terms and conditions of such appointment, including remuneration, are subject to the approval of the shareholders, as per the relevant provisions of the Companies Act, 2013, and SEBI (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015 (“Listing Regulation”).
(6)
In light of the aforementioned facts and recognizing the valuable experience and expertise that Mr. Manoj Kumar Digga brings to the Company, the Board recommends the approval of shareholders for appointment of Mr. Manoj Kumar Digga as an Executive Director, as detailed out in resolution. The details of the proposed remuneration payable to him are set out below:
| Sl. No. | Particulars | Details |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Basic Salary | Rs. 5 Lakh per month |
| 2 | House Rent Allowance |
Rs. 2.50 Lakh per month |
| 3 | Other Allowance | Rs. 2.24 Lakh per month |
Apart from the above fixed remuneration Mr. Manoj Digga shall also be entitled for F.Y. 2024-25 to the following:
One-time-Performance Bonus of Rs. 30.00 Lakh for successful restructuring
Annual Variable pay of Rs. 20.00 Lakh on achieving certain milestones
Minimum Remuneration
Where in any financial year(s) during the currency of the tenure of Mr. Manoj Kumar Digga as an Executive Director, the Company has no profits or its profits are inadequate, the Company shall pay to Mr. Manoj Kumar Digga in respect of such financial year(s) in which such inadequacy or loss arises or a period of three years, whichever is lower, the remuneration as set out above by way of consolidated salary, perquisites and allowances as minimum remuneration, in accordance with the provisions of Section 197 and / or Schedule V to the Companies Act, 2013 (as amended) (the “Act”).

Annexure-A
Statement containing required information pursuant to Section II of Schedule V of the Act for all the Executive Directors in case of Inadequate Profit:
I. General Information
1. Nature of industry
Erection, Procurement and Construction (EPC)
2. Date or expected date of commencement of commercial production:
Not Applicable
3. Financial performance based on given indicators
| Financial performance based on given indicators | |
|---|---|
| Financialyear 2023-24 | (Rs. in Lacs) |
| Revenue from operations | 1,31,838.40 |
| Proft before Tax | 2,072.25 |
| Proft after Tax | 1,951.62 |
4. Foreign investments or collaborations, if any.
As of 31[st] March, 2024 the aggregate number of Equity Shares held by Foreign Company is 54,93,876 Equity Shares of Rs. 2/each which constitutes 11.22 % of the Paid up Equity Share Capital of the Company.
There is no foreign collaboration for any equity investment.

III. Other Information
1. Reasons of loss or inadequate profits
The Company was going through the financial crunch, unable to pay dues of the financial creditor. Hence, the Consortium of lenders has assigned their entire debt to National Asset Reconstruction Company Ltd (NARCL). Thereafter, NARCL had restructure the debt of the Company.
2. Steps taken or proposed to be taken for improvement
The management of the Company is taking every possible step to improve the operation of the Company. With the resolution plan Company is in a position to reap the benefits of ample available market opportunities in water sector and for revival and turnaround.
3. Expected increase in productivity and profits in measurable terms
With Resolution Plan in place with substantial certainty of repayment of dues from identified sources, your Company is in a position to reap the benefits of ample available market opportunities in water sector and for revival and turnaround.
